How much caffeine is in a 5 hour shot?

5-Hour Energy packs more caffeine in its 1.93-ounce frame than many of its larger canned competitors. The regular-strength shooter — offered in berry, grape, citrus lime, pomegranate, orange and pink lemonade — holds 200 milligrams of caffeine, according to its website.

How many ounces of Rockstar Energy Drink?

RockStar Energy Drink is available in cans sized 8.4 ounces, 12 ounces, 16 ounces and 24 ounces. A 16-ounce can of original Rockstar carries 160 milligrams of caffeine and 32 grams of carbs, 31 grams of which come from sugar. Other ingredients include L-carnitine, pyridoxine hydrochloride and cyanocobalamin.

How many calories are in a 16 oz Mountain Dew Amp?

Mountain Dew/Itemmaster. Mountain Dew Amp is your classic Mountain Dew, but amped up. One 16-ounce serving of Mountain Dew Amp contains 220 calories, 58 grams of sugar, 10 milligrams of sodium and 142 milligrams of caffeine. The brand also uses high fructose corn syrup as a sweetener, according to the Pepsico website.

How many calories are in a NOS can?

NOS original, also produced by Monster Beverage Corporation, has 210 calories, 410 milligrams of sodium and 53 grams of sugar per can. A 16-ounce can holds 160 milligrams of caffeine, according to the nutrition label on the NOS website.

What is the most caffeinated energy drink?

Wired Energy Drinks. With a whopping 505 mg caffeine, Wired X505 is the most caffeinated energy drink on the market. And it doesn't stop at caffeine — it also contains high amounts of other eye-openers, like 4,400 mg of taurine, 375 mg of guarana, and 750% of your daily recommended value of vitamin B6.

How much caffeine is in Fixx?

With 500 mg of caffeine per bottle, Fixx is the second most caffeinated energy drink on this list and one of the most concentrated ever on the market. For reference, the FDA caps healthy caffeine consumption at 400 mg a day, which is roughly four or five cups of regular brewed coffee.

How did Anais Fournier die?

One death was the case of 14-year-old Anais Fournier, who died due to a cardiac arrhythmia induced by caffeine toxicity after consuming two Monster Energy drinks in 24 hours. The company has denied any part in Fournier's death.

What are the ingredients in Four Loko?

Four Loko's name reportedly comes from its original formula's four main ingredients: alcohol, caffeine, taurine, and guarana. Caffeine, taurine and guarana are all stimulants, making this 23.5-ounce drink a real eye-opener. It was also nothing to scoff at in terms of alcohol content, weighing in at 12% ABV.

Why is Absinthe considered a green fairy?

Banned in the United States from 1915-2007, Absinthe is commonly referred to as the “green fairy” due to its hallucinogenic properties . Trace amounts of the chemical thujone were thought to be responsible for producing mild hallucinations where the user is known to see a small green fairy, however, upon the study of this occurrence, the appearance of a green fairy is now proven to be exaggerated and more of a pop-culture myth. With slightly lower alcohol content than Everclear, Absinthe is typically produced as a 90-146 proof liquor. As with any alcoholic beverage, the risk of endangering health increases with the amount consumed. Due to Absinthe’s potency, it is important to drink with extreme moderation.

Is moonshine illegal in the US?

Throughout the years, states have lifted bans prohibiting moonshine, however, it is still illegal to brew liquor within a personal residence. Due to the reversing of these bans, moonshine has experienced commercial success in recent years. The proof of traditional, prohibition-era moonshine ranged from 63 proof to 190 proof, whereas today the proof ranges from 60 to 120 proof. Although strictly controlled, commercial moonshine still has high alcohol content and should be used in moderation. Illicitly manufactured moonshine remains very dangerous as the alcohol content is not strictly monitored and consuming this liquor should be avoided.

Is Everclear 190 proof?

Due to the dangers associated with Everclear’s high alcohol percentage, some U.S. states have prohibited the sale of 190 proof liquor. In response, the manufacturer of Everclear, Luxco, began distribution of Everclear at 189 proof, bypassing these state laws. Because Everclear is undiluted and 92.4% pure ethanol, the grain alcohol is also used as a household cleaner and disinfectant. For an average individual, a cocktail containing one to two shots of Everclear would be sufficient in reaching dangerous levels of intoxication.
